The Role of a Car Locksmith
A car locksmith, likewise referred to as an automotive locksmith, is a specialist who focuses on the security of automobiles. Their primary obligations consist of:
- Key Duplication: Creating duplicate keys for vehicle owners, typically when the original key is lost or damaged.
- Key Programming: Programming electronic or chip keys for contemporary vehicles that need particular coding to run.
- Lock Repair and Replacement: Fixing or replacing damaged locks on car doors, trunks, and ignition systems.
- Lockout Assistance: Helping vehicle owners who have been locked out of their cars and trucks, providing quick and effective access.
- Security Consultation: Advising clients on the best ways to protect their automobiles against theft and unapproved gain access to.
- Setup of Security Systems: Installing advanced security systems, such as immobilizers and alarms, to improve vehicle security.
The Tools of the Trade
Car locksmiths use a range of specialized tools to perform their tasks. A few of the most common tools consist of:
- Key Machines: These machines are utilized to cut and replicate keys precisely.
- Select Sets: Sets of lock choices utilized to manipulate the pins inside a lock and open it without a key.
- Decoders: Devices that checked out the unique codes of chip keys, permitting locksmiths to program new keys.
- Drill Rigs: Used as a last hope to drill out locks that can not be picked or have actually been harmed beyond repair.
- Laptop computer and Software: For programming and identifying issues with electronic locks and security systems.
- Telescopic Mirrors: These mirrors aid locksmith professionals see into tight areas, such as keyholes, to much better understand the lock system.
- Stress Wrenches: Tools used to use the required tension to a lock while picking it.

FAQs About Car Locksmiths
How do I find a reliable car locksmith?
- Look for locksmith professionals with good reviews and a solid credibility. Check if they are certified and insured. You can likewise request for recommendations from good friends, household, or local automotive forums.
Can a car locksmith open a car without a key?
- Yes, car locksmiths are trained to open vehicles without causing damage. They utilize lock selecting, key extraction, and other methods to gain access.
How long does it take to get a brand-new key made?
- The time it requires to make a brand-new key depends upon the intricacy of the lock and the kind of key. Basic mechanical keys can be made in a few minutes, while electronic keys may take an hour or more.
What should I do if I lose my car keys?
- Contact a relied on car locksmith right away. They can supply a new key and assist you protect your vehicle. It's likewise an excellent idea to report the lost keys to your insurer and the cops, specifically if you think foul play.
Are car locksmith professionals covered by insurance coverage?
- Numerous insurance plan cover the expense of locksmith services if the requirement develops due to a covered event, such as a burglary. Check your policy to see if locksmith services are included.
Can a car locksmith assist with a broken key in the ignition?
- Yes, car locksmith professionals can extract broken keys from locks and replace the key or the lock if required.
